About the piece
Jan van de Cappelle’s 'Winter Scene' from 1652 is a quintessential example of Dutch Golden Age landscape painting. The work beautifully captures the stillness of a frozen river where figures engage in daily life amidst snow-dusted thatched cottages and bare, frost-rimmed trees. The true focus of the piece is the towering sky, showcasing the artist's celebrated ability to render light and atmosphere through soft, rolling clouds.
